What is Highlevel CRM?
Highlevel CRM, often referred to simply as HighLevel, is a comprehensive Customer Relationship Management (CRM) platform designed specifically for marketers, agencies, and businesses aiming to streamline their operations and boost their customer engagement strategies. This platform distinguishes itself through its multifunctionality, offering not just CRM capabilities but also tools for marketing automation, sales funnel creation, and communication management. The most important goal of Highlevel CRM is to amalgamate various business processes and tools into a single, unified system, thereby enabling businesses to operate more efficiently and effectively.

Are there any limitations of Highlevel CRM for small businesses?
While Highlevel CRM is packed with features beneficial for small businesses, it’s essential to consider its limitations. A significant hurdle is the learning curve for advanced features. The complexity of advanced automation setup and custom reporting tools may demand a considerable investment of time and effort to fully leverage.
Additionally, Highlevel CRM faces limited integrations with third-party apps, a constraint that could pose challenges for businesses that depend on a diverse ecosystem of external tools and services. Recognizing these limitations is vital for small businesses to determine if Highlevel CRM meets their specific requirements and operational framework.
Learning curve for advanced features
Highlevel CRM’s advanced features present a notable learning curve. The platform’s advanced automation setup and custom reporting tools are potent but require a significant investment in time and effort to fully grasp and utilize effectively, posing a challenge for small businesses with limited resources.
Limited integrations compared to larger CRMs
In comparison to larger CRM solutions, Highlevel CRM has limited integrations with third-party applications. This limitation manifests as fewer third-party app integrations, potentially constraining small businesses that depend on a broad ecosystem of external tools and services for comprehensive operational functionality.
